Is 1.8 GHz good for a laptop?

Well 1.8 GHz is fast for a human, but only middling fast for a computer. A single cycle at 1.8 GHz takes 555 picoseconds or about half a nanosecond. A nanosecond is a billionth of a second.

Is 3.5 GHz fast?

A clock speed of 3.5 GHz to 4.0 GHz is generally considered a good clock speed for gaming but it’s more important to have good single-thread performance. This means that your CPU does a good job of understanding and completing single tasks. This is not to be confused with having a single-core processor.

How many GHz is the fastest processor?

AMD announced that their new 8-core Bulldozer FX processor clocked a record speed of 8.429GHz with the help of liquid nitrogen and helium.

What determines the speed and power of a computer?

A computer’s speed and processing power aren’t attributable to a single component. It takes a number of pieces of hardware working together to determine your computer’s overall performance. What it all boils down to is how well, and how quickly, all the important components communicate with each other to perform actions.

Which is the fastest computer in the world?

When it was unveiled in October 2012, the Titan claimed the title of world’s fastest computer, which had been held by the IBM Sequoia Blue Gene /Q machine at the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ory in California for just six months [sources: Burt, Johnston].
